2 What Are Cookies & Terminal Storage?

A cookie is a small alphanumeric text file delivered by a web server and stored in your web browser’s local cache directory when visiting an online service. On subsequent visits, your browser transmits these tokens back to the server to maintain continuity.

Along with standard HTTP cookies, we may make limited use of alternative client-side storage technologies, including:

  • Session Storage: Ephemeral variables cleared immediately upon closing your active browser tab.
  • Local Storage (HTML5): Persistent client-side key-value pairs stored without automatic expiration, used for interface preferences such as syntax highlighting or tutorial checklist progress.
  • Server Request Headers: Standard diagnostic logging records containing user-agent strings and IP addresses for cybersecurity monitoring.

Browser-Level Controls

Most modern web browsers allow you to manage cookie parameters globally or per individual domain. To adjust settings directly within your browser, consult the official guidance provided by your browser vendor:

  • Google Chrome: Settings > Privacy & Security > Third-party cookies
  • Mozilla Firefox: Settings > Privacy & Security > Enhanced Tracking Protection
  • Apple Safari: Preferences > Privacy > Prevent cross-site tracking
  • Microsoft Edge: Settings > Cookies and site permissions > Manage and delete cookies
